nwhitehorn 2008-10-30 04:01:11 UTC FreeBSD src repository Modified files: (Branch: RELENG_7) sys/dev/bm if_bm.c sys/powerpc/include dbdma.h sys/powerpc/powermac dbdma.c dbdmavar.h Log: SVN rev 184461 on 2008-10-30 04:01:11Z by nwhitehorn MFC r183288,183411,183827,184382: Expand DBDMA API to allow setting device-dependent control bits and allow DBDMA registers to lie in a subregion of a resource. Also import changes to the BMAC driver to handle these changes and change the way we enable the BMAC cell in macio. Instead of calling the macio's enable-enet word, which apparently does nothing on some machines, open an OF instance of the ethernet controller. This fixes cold booting from disk on my Blue & White G3.
